Job description

Job Description

This position is responsible for assisting with food preparation, serving, cleaning, and providing resident service to assist with the mission of the households.

Application Deadline

2026-09-30

Job Type

County

Status

Full-Time Non-Exempt

Hours

One Full-Time PM Position- Hours: 10:15am-6:30pm; Some Weekends Required

Starting Wage

$17.65/hr.

Weekend Differential

PLUS $3.00 Per Hour Weekend Differential

Benefits
  • Paid Time Off (PTO) – available for use after 30 days of employment
  • 10 observed paid holidays
  • Health, Dental, Vision Insurance
  • Health Savings Account (HSA) – with employer contributions – HRA
  • Life insurance, Long-term disability and Flex spending
  • Participation in the Wisconsin Retirement System (WRS) – if over 1200 hours/year
Essential Functions
  • Maintains compliance with food handling safety standards and sanitation procedures; reports unsafe conditions, hazardous equipment, or accidents immediately.
  • Maintains food storage, work areas, and associated spaces in a clean and safe condition according to established policies and procedures.
  • Washes and sanitizes dishes, counters, kitchen equipment, and floors assuring Health Department standards of sanitation and safety are met at all times.
  • Routinely cleans stoves, steamtables, oven equipment, refrigerator, freezer, floors, etc.
  • Maintains orderly and safe storage of food and supplies.
  • Preps hot dish ingredients and cold-serve foods.
  • Assists the Cook in preparation of high-quality, bulk quantities of menu items in accordance with established recipes.
  • Assists in setting up serving lines; serves and feeds as needed.
  • Reports change of resident condition and tracks/updates resident diet changes.
  • Clears and clean tables and chairs after use.
  • Cleans up spills or breakage immediately.
  • Restocks condiments and dishes/silverware as needed.
  • Empties and cleans trash receptacles.
  • Provides backup assistance to other department personnel as needed.
  • Other duties as assigned.

PHYSICAL AND WORK ENVIRONMENT

This work requires the occasional exertion of up to 50 pounds of force; work regularly requires sitting, frequently requires standing, speaking or hearing, using hands to finger, handle or feel and repetitive motions and occasionally requires walking, stooping, kneeling, crouching or crawling and reaching with hands and arms.

Work has standard vision requirements.

Vocal communication is required for expressing or exchanging ideas by means of the spoken word.

Hearing is required to perceive information in moderately loud conditions.

Work requires using of measuring devices, operating kitchen equipment and observing general surroundings and activities.

Work frequently requires exposure to extreme cold (refrigerators/freezers) and exposure to extreme heat (stoves/ovens/fryers) and occasionally requires wet, humid conditions (non-weather), working near moving mechanical parts and exposure to chemicals.

Work is primarily in a kitchen preparatory setting and dining/serving setting.

Work environment includes exposure to infectious agents, chemical agents, and resident behaviors.
